Gentle Workouts
Gentle workouts are perfect for individuals of all fitness levels, including beginners and those recovering from injuries. These exercises aim to improve strength, flexibility, and balance without putting excessive strain on the joints. Some popular forms of gentle workouts include yoga, tai chi, and aquatic exercises.
Benefits of Gentle Workouts:
- Enhance flexibility and mobility
- Build strength and endurance
- Reduce stress and promote relaxation
- Improve posture and body awareness

Pilates for Strength
Pilates is a form of exercise that focuses on core strength, flexibility, and overall body awareness. Developed by Joseph Pilates in the early 20th century, Pilates exercises target the deep muscles of the abdomen and spine, promoting good posture and alignment. Pilates can be performed on a mat or using specialized equipment like the reformer.
Benefits of Pilates:
- Strengthen core muscles
- Improve flexibility and balance
- Enhance muscle tone and endurance
- Prevent injuries by correcting imbalances
